San Marcos City Council welcomed new and re-elected City Council members during a swearing ceremony on Nov. 18.
Re-elected Council Member Saul Gonzales kept his seat for Place 2 with 59.58% of votes in three-way race against LMC (Lisa Marie Coppoletta) and Devin Barrett.
New City Council Member Maxfield Baker won the Place 1 seat in a tight race against Mark Gleason, taking the victory by only 30 votes.
